The history lover in me thoroughly enjoys learning about everything, so I Googled Swarovski to find out more about the company. Here are some of the most interesting bits of information:
  • It is an Austrian company that was founded by Daniel Swarovski in 1895.
  • The crystal stone drew wide attention in the 1920s when the “flapper” style of dress began to include fringed and crystal creations (such as ribbons of fabric studded with crystals).
  • In 1956 the Aurora Borealis innovation was introduced. The crystals were coated in a thin layer of metal to give them additional sparkle.
  • The company celebrated 100 years in 1995.
  • In 1999 they introduced crystal tattoos that can be attached to the body.
  • The collection includes all kinds of jewellery, watches, figurines, and much, much more...
